.elementor-227 .elementor-element.elementor-element-78c5491{--display:flex;--flex-direction:row;--container-widget-width:initial;--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--flex-wrap-mobile:wrap;--gap:0px 20px;--row-gap:0px;--column-gap:20px;--margin-top:2%;--margin-bottom:2%;--margin-left:0%;--margin-right:0%;--padding-top:0%;--padding-bottom:0%;--padding-left:0%;--padding-right:0%;}.elementor-227 .elementor-element.elementor-element-2ed193f{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;}.elementor-widget-heading .elementor-heading-title{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-weight:var( --e-global-typography-primary-font-weight );color:var( --e-global-color-primary );}.elementor-227 .elementor-element.elementor-element-9d19c23 .elementor-heading-title{font-family:"Roboto", Sans-serif;font-size:2rem;font-weight:600;}@media(min-width:768px){.elementor-227 .elementor-element.elementor-element-78c5491{--content-width:1320px;}.elementor-227 .elementor-element.elementor-element-2ed193f{--width:100%;}}/* Start custom CSS for shortcode, class: .elementor-element-4cf74d0 */.div-arquivos-evento img {
    padding: 5px;
    float: left;
    margin-left: 10px;
    /* margin-right: 10px; */
    cursor: pointer;
}
.div-arquivos-evento {
    float: left;
    width: 278px;
    text-align: center;
}
.div-detalhes-evento {
    float: left;

}
.div-arquivos-evento {
    float: left;

    text-align: center;
}
.div-arquivos-evento span {
    display: block;
    width: 100px;
    float: left;
    text-align: center;
    font-size: 13px;
    font-weight: bold;
    font-family: Tahoma, Sans-Serif;
    margin-bottom: 5px;
    /* margin-left: 10px; */
    margin-right: 10px;
}
.div-arquivos-evento img {
    padding: 5px;
    float: left;
    margin-left: 10px;
    cursor: pointer;
    max-width: 100px!important;
    margin-right:0!important;
}
.label1 {
    font-weight: bold;
}
.cabecalho-detalhe {
    padding: 5px 10px;
    margin-bottom: 10px;
    border: 1px solid #000;
}
.corpo-detalhe01 {
    margin-left: 20px;
}
.simple-grid {margin-top:20px;
display: inline-block;!important}

table.simple-grid td {
    vertical-align: middle !important;
}

.container {margin:0!important;}

/* IPad */
@media screen and (max-width: 1024px){


}/* End custom CSS */